Idaho’s prisons are full. Corrections agency will request $45.3 million to open 3 new facilities.

Correction: This story was corrected at 9 a.m., Sept. 16 to reflect that women state prison inmates are not sent out of state due to a shortage of beds. They are sent to county jails.

If a woman incarcerated at the South Idaho Correctional Institution in Kuna has a dentist appointment, she has to walk through the men’s side of the prison to attend it. To do that, correctional staff must shut down much …
